From 2879636d55312b5391ec46c7dee5d3a07714c222 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Peter Maydell Date: Wed, 18 Jul 2012 11:11:09 +0100 Subject: update-linux-headers.sh: Don't hard code list of architectures Rather than hardcoding the list of architectures in the kernel header update script, just import headers for every architecture which supports KVM (with a blacklist exception for ia64 which has KVM headers but is dead). This reduces the number of QEMU files which need to be updated to add support for a new KVM architecture.
